Not much of a goose fan. I honestly believe that most people get more excited about the size and amount of meat they get than the actual flavor. I shoot them when they come by but I would rather shoot 8 greenwing teal than 8 Canadas (Specks are a completely different story).

That said I'd rather eat the goose legs than the breasts. Braised slowly or simmered under duck fat, they are amazing. I had one year where I shot well over 100 geese while duck hunting. We turned the bulk of them into hotdogs for the kids. They tasted like hotdogs.
